Dimensions

Length: 4.77 m4.52 m
Width: 1.86 m1.73 m
Height: 1.34 m1.30 m
BMW 8 series is larger.
BMW 8 series is 25 cm longer than the Nissan 200 SX, 13 cm wider, while the height of BMW 8 series is 4 cm higher.
Trunk capacity: 320 litres307 litres
BMW 8 series has 13 litres more trunk space than the Nissan 200 SX.
Turning diameter: 12 meters9.6 meters
The turning circle of the BMW 8 series is 2.4 metres more than that of the Nissan 200 SX, which means BMW 8 series can be harder to manoeuvre in tight streets and parking spaces.
